回收西门子主机模块,回收西门子电子签名,西门子软件回收
现金回收原装西门子电子签名
回收西门子主机模块,回收西门子电子签名,西门子软件回收
现金回收原装西门子电子签名
SCATTER
图2 SCATTER指令详情
V1.0版本:SCATTER指令是将位序列(Byte、Word、DWord)分解成Bool数组,其中Byte分解成8Bool元素的数组,Word分解成16Bool元素的数组,DWord分解成32Bool元素的数组。LAD需要在下拉框“???”选择输入类型(Byte、Word、DWord),SCL无需选择。IN是待分解的位序列变量,OUT是Bool数组名,元素数量必须正好符合要求。
V1.1版本:OUT除Bool数组之外,可以是Struct、UDT类型的变量,变量内是连续的8Bool、16Bool、32Bool,OUT处填写Struct、UDT类型的变量名。
注:LAD版本的SCATTER,如果调用该块的OB\FB\FC如果没有激活IEC检查,IN变量支持整数、字符、TIME、DATE、TOD类型。
使用举例,如图3-5所示:
1. 将Word变量"DB66".Static_1分解成Array[0..15] ofBool变量"DB66".Static_2,将Byte变量"DB66".Static_3分解成UDT中的连续8个Bool变量Tag_3
图3 DB66的定义
图4 Q点在PLC变量表的定义
图5 程序详情xiangbaijiao